The app works by using your phone number to identify you. If you’re out of wi-fi, WhatsApp will use your cellular data connection. As a result, yoWhatsApp can easily eat into your data allowance. To monitor how much you’re spending on data, head over to the Settings menu and click on Network Usage. You can adjust the way you download messages and limit your data consumption by adjusting your download options.

Another benefit of WhatsApp is its privacy features. End-to-end encryption ensures that no third party will be able to read your messages.
